Output 7de81c3dad97487733dec7b4eb8a39c9817998e21dd579a175002befc6e31061:0

value
12040522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a8e734e89bb64f61a296a293c164fd0bddb077 OP_EQUAL
address
3E4KV38XLAyodXez6copdfCeZguyV5cSMw
transaction
7de81c3dad97487733dec7b4eb8a39c9817998e21dd579a175002befc6e31061
spent
true